Man armed with knife shot by police in gresham, Gresham OR
Heads up: This post was detected from real-time dispatch audio. Information may be incomplete, and the situation may evolve. Always verify using official agency releases.
Police responded to a report of a man armed with a knife in a car on East Powell Boulevard in Gresham. Officers gave commands to the man in the backseat waving the knife. Shots were fired, resulting in the man being down. Medics were requested at the scene. Officers found no other weapons and observed bruises on a victim.
